Software Engineer II

With the rise of Microsoft Dynamics 365, business applications have become famous around the world today. This particular Microsoft facility is best for focusing on innovations in aspects such as end-to-end digital transformation, predictive analysis, augmented reality, and machine learning.

If you want to build business software using SaaS, this is a perfect job for you. You would have to be responsible for the performance of features, usability, and accountability of the software quality. You would have to excel in designing and testing the application after development at the same time.

Your Qualifications

If you aim at becoming a software engineer in Microsoft, you need to have at least three years of experience as a software development professional. The languages at a minimum that you would need to know are Java, C++, and C#. It would help if you had a master’s for a bachelor’s degree in the computer science field. It would be better if you are an Engineer.

You should also have experience and knowledge in maintaining court, debugging, and developing object-oriented languages. It will be a strong point if you excel in problem-solving and coding skills.

You would have to have prior experience in either linear programming or combinatorial algorithms. Better communication skills would allow you to shine brighter in the job and fulfil your mission.

Azure Dev Support Engineer

If you want to work more as a person who empowers others to achieve success, this is a perfect position. As an Azure Dev Support Engineer, you can become a participant in an open environment and work with great minds. For this position, you need to have powerful problem-solving skills to help the customers quickly.

Resolving facility-related problems would be your primary objective once you join the Azure Dev Support Engineer company.

Your primary focus would be around improving the product or services and support experience, helping your colleagues at the same time.

Your Qualifications

You want to have experience in various coding languages and frameworks such as WordPress, Java, Python, .Net core, Ruby, PHP, ASP.NET, Drupal a plus, and Joomla. High CSS and HTML would be appreciated in Microsoft.

Most importantly, you must also possess troubleshooting skills to solve the issues effectively. Lastly, you need to understand several concepts of programming, such as performance aspects, debugging, synchronization, threading, and call stacks.
